DESY CXXIII - "Paris"

Serie "Despojos da Indigencia" 2025 , Paris e as suas Luzes. A cidade Luz
As pessoas mais velhas carregam na memória as luzes da cidade que iluminaram seus caminhos ao longo da vida. Cada esquina acesa desperta lembranças, enquanto suas presenças dão à cidade um brilho mais calmo e cheio de história.


Desy CXXIII (born in Guarda, 1985) grew up surrounded by comic books. Around age 17, he developed a strong interest in drawing, starting with sketches inspired by comic characters. In 2002 he entered the art world through urban art and graffiti.

He works with multiple supports — paper, walls, cellophane, urban furniture, canvas, and glass — often using discarded materials. His art emphasizes transparency, layering, and color contrasts that produce a powerful visual impact. His subjects and techniques explore themes of social exclusion, inequality, capitalism’s abuses, environmental degradation, and the loss of human values.
His work often portrays elderly or marginalized figures — abandoned by society yet carriers of hidden stories — rendered through layered spray-painted glass and other recycled materials.

Exhibitions & Projects

2012: Founded Atelier 33 in Guarda.
2013–2015: Early solo shows (Desy33 at Atelier 33; Artem Vandalism at TMG-Guarda) and live mural collaborations with artists such as L7Matrix (Brazil).
2016: Solo exhibitions in Pinhel and Guarda (13), residency at Gallery 44309 (Dortmund), and projects in Rome and Loures.
2017–2018: Invited for SIAC 2 (Guarda), Loures Arte Pública, and international street art festivals including UpFest (Bristol, UK) and Le Lavo//matik (Paris, France).
2019: Tribute mural to Raul Solnado (Tondela).
2020–2021: Murals for 25 April Revolution commemorations in Guarda and Loures, plus curating Arte Nos Bairros (SIAC 5).
2022: Commemorations for the 100th anniversary of the South Atlantic crossing by Gago Coutinho (Celorico da Beira), murals in Gouveia and Nelas, and the exhibition Despojos da Indigência.
2023: Solo exhibition 3XP3RIMENTAL at Museu da Guarda (Galeria Evelina Coelho).
2024: Collective exhibition As Memórias dos Outros (TMG, Guarda, DGArtes-funded) and solo participation at Festival Opensounds Alpedrinha.

International Reach

He has painted and exhibited in Portugal (Lisbon, Porto, Coimbra, Loures, Guarda, etc.) and internationally in France, the UK, Germany, Italy, Belgium, Luxembourg, and Switzerland. His works are included in private collections across Europe.
Critical Note

According to biographer João Mendes Rosa, Desy’s most recent work shows a clear artistic maturity, conveying strong social concerns:
Social inequalities driven by exploitative capitalism.
Erosion of human values (friendship, solidarity, justice) replaced by materialism and individualism.
Environmental degradation from mass production and uncontrolled consumption.

Through his art, Desy reclaims discarded materials, giving voice to marginalized individuals — “the abandoned ones who are, in truth, the hidden gold of our society.”
